    1. Description

    Internal face spring energized seals is the standard seal for axial (face) applications. It has a high spring loading, which gives excellent sealing integrity at low pressure and is available for both internal and external pressure.

    The heavy helical spring in DVE makes it the best choice for vacuum, gas and low temperature flange sealing applications.

    3. Technical Data

    Operating pressure:
    Maximum static load: 60 MPa / 8,702 psi
    Maximum dynamic load: 20 MPa / 2,900 psi (207 MPa / 30,000 psi with Back-up Ring)
    Speed: Static to slow rotating or pivoting movements
    Operating temperature: -150 °C to +200 °C / -238 °F to +392 °F
    Media compatibility: Virtually all fluids, chemicals compatibility: and gases

    4. Areas of Application

    - Compressor housings
    - Construction equipment and plant
    - Chemical processing
    - Crude oil and natural gas installations
    - Cryogenic engineering
    - Nuclear power
    - Vacuum applications
    - Pivot joints
